Shin-Koiwa (新小岩, literally "New small rock") is a neighborhood next to Koiwa in Katsushika, Tokyo, Japan. The neighborhood's main traffic hub is Shin-Koiwa Station served by the Sōbu and Chūō-Sōbu Lines.

Residential street in Shinkoiwa

As of 2000, the neighborhood is home to some 20,496 people.[1]

Most of the shopping and business life is centered on the station square and shōtengai shopping street extending from the station.
